1. Data Engineering in the Cloud
More and more firms are moving to cloud platforms like Google Cloud, AWS, and Azure.
Cloud-native tools and services are taking over the data engineering world because they can scale, are flexible, and can handle data in real time.
Q: Will data engineers need to know how to use the cloud in 2025?
A: Yes. Cloud skills are no longer optional, in reality. Employers want engineers to know how to use cloud-native databases, orchestration tools, and monitoring solutions.
2. The rise of data pipelines that work in real time
Batch processing isn't enough on its own anymore since businesses like e-commerce, fintech, and healthcare need rapid insights.
Real-time data pipelines are becoming more popular. People really want tools like Apache Kafka, Flink, and Spark Streaming.
Q: Why are real-time pipelines so important these days?
A: Because businesses can't afford to wait. For example, banks need to be able to quickly handle fraud detection, and e-commerce needs to be able to quickly personalize. Data engineers need to create systems that can give that kind of speed.
3. Automation and DataOps
DataOps, which is also known as DevOps for data, is becoming the norm in the industry.
Automating monitoring, error management, and deployment of data pipelines will save time and cut down on mistakes made by people.
Q: What will DataOps mean for data engineers?
A: Engineers will no longer have to manually maintain pipelines; instead, they will focus on creating automated workflows that can correct themselves, grow on their own, and make sure they follow the rules.
4. Working with AI and Machine Learning
Data engineering isn't only about "data plumbing" anymore. Engineers should work closely with data scientists and AI teams in 2025.
You need to know how to build pipelines that send machine learning models clean, structured, and scalable data.
Q: Will AI take over the jobs of data engineers?
A: No. AI will help them do their jobs better, but people will always be the best at architecture, governance, and compliance.
5. More attention to data security and governance
As data privacy laws and rules like GDPR, CCPA, and India's Data Protection Bill become more common, engineers need to put governance, lineage, and regulation at the top of their to-do lists. In 2025, tools that make it possible to audit and be open are very important.
Q: Do engineers need to know about laws that say they have to follow?
A: Yes, A. Companies are seeking engineers who not only know how to use technical tools but also know how to handle sensitive data safely.
6. Handling Data in Many Ways.
The modern business doesn't only work with structured data. Engineers today have to deal with graph data, semi-structured data (like JSON and XML), and unstructured data (like text, photos, and audio). Being able to work with multi-modal data is becoming a key skill.
Q: What tools work best for working with unstructured data?
A: More and more people are using tools like Elasticsearch, MongoDB, and Databricks Lakehouse to manage a wide range of datasets more effectively.
7. Data Engineering on the Edge
As more and more IoT devices come out, edge data processing is becoming necessary. To cut down on latency, engineers need to design systems that can process data closer to where it comes from.
Q: Is edge data engineering useful in all fields?
A: It's vital in healthcare (for example, wearable devices), self-driving cars, and smart cities. The trend is growing, but not every industry needs it yet.
